Ukraine ready to receive F-16 fighter jets

Ukraine ready to receive F-16 fighter jets

Secretary of the National Security and Defense Council of Ukraine Oleksiy Danilov announced on Ukrainian Channel 24 that Ukraine is going to receive the F-16 fighter jets.

In late January, Adviser to the Ukrainian Air Force Yuriy Ignat had said that their partners were ready to transfer F-16 fighter jets to Kyiv, but not everything was ready for the receipt.

“Infrastructure for the F-16s is being prepared; our partners are providing us with utmost aid. I will not say exactly what kind of infrastructure it is and where it is stationed, but this is a complex act, and everything goes ahead as planned,” Danilov said.

Earlier, the Financial Times reported that a coalition of 11 countries will begin training Ukrainian pilots to operate the F-16 fighter jets. According to the Ukrainian defense minister, the coalition includes Denmark, the Netherlands, Belgium, Canada, Luxembourg, Norway, Poland, Portugal, Romania, Sweden and the U.K..
